Global Indoor Positioning and Navigation Market (2020 to 2025) - Featuring Google, Qualcomm & Microsoft Among Others - ResearchAndMarkets.com

DUBLIN--()--The "Indoor Positioning and Navigation Market - Forecast (2020 - 2025)" report has been added to ResearchAndMarkets.com's offering.

The global Indoor Positioning and Navigation market was valued at $6.92 billion in 2020 and is projected to grow to $23.6 billion in 2025 at a CAGR of 27.9%.

Developed countries in North America and Europe remain the largest market for Indoor Positioning and Navigation Systems sales which accounts for a major share in the global market. The USA is a major market in for Indoor Positioning and Navigation in Americas accounting around 40% share in the global market. The market in the USA was valued at $2.78 billion in 2020 and is anticipated to grow to $9.58 billion in 2025 at a CAGR of 28.1%. In the Asia Pacific, China and Japan are the major contributors in this market. The market in the Asia Pacific is rapidly growing owing to the increased penetration and growing applications of indoor positioning and navigation in aviation, healthcare, logistics etc., at a CAGR of 31.8% and it is expected to reach $7.52 billion by 2025.

The European market is expected to reach $8.75 billion in 2025 growing at a CAGR of 25.6%. The growing applications of indoor positioning and navigation systems and consumer demands are driving the market in Europe. UK holds the largest share in the European market for indoor positioning and navigation which accounts around 25% share in its market and Germany comes next to the UK with a share around 21% in the European Indoor Positioning and Navigation Market.

Indoor Positioning and Navigation Market Trends:

  • Google is developing an indoor location positioning technology based on its Tango Augmented Reality (AR) system. This new technology is called Visual Positioning Service (VPS). It will allow a mobile device to swiftly and accurately understand its position indoors. Using visual clues from distinct features in the room, a Tango-enabled phone would be able to recognize where it is in space by comparing new points captured by its camera with previously observed ones.
  • January 24, 2020: Here Technologies, a mapping company valued at around $3 billion has acquired Micello, a company based in California that operates a platform for creating, editing and publishing indoor maps. This acquisition will support HERE's strategy to provide world-class mapping and advanced location services both indoors and outdoors. In combination with HERE's unique tracking technologies, indoor maps will enable new and innovative market solutions such as the tracking of parts on a factory floor, the optimization of workspace usage, indoor wayfinding at complex transit interchanges, and last mile guidance in vehicles.
  • Fantasmo, a notable technology start-up, has camera positioning standard (CPS) which captures spatial data through your device's camera. With this data stored in a server, AR apps can readily and accurately determine position and location relative to recognized landmarks in the immediate vicinity. Fantasmo's approach also mirrors another startup, 6D.ai, whose platform can capture a dense 3D mesh with smartphone cameras while running in the background.
  • Sydney airport introduces Apple Maps. Getting around Sydney Airport just got easier due to the gateway's adoption of Apple Maps (web mapping service), which shows users how to navigate their way through T1 International, T2/T3 Domestic terminals and its car parks. Customers can now easily find facilities and services inside the terminal, including restrooms, parent's rooms, elevators and shops, and see current location with indoor positioning.
  • Infsoft 360 Antennas' Angle of Arrival technology has spurred a new way about how to calculate location. These receiver antennas detect the radio signals emitted by any mobile 2.4 GHz transmitter (e.g. beacon) that is in range. Based on the angle and distance determined, it is possible to calculate the position of an object equipped with such transmitter with an accuracy of 1 to 3 meters. This makes server-based BLE solutions a favorable alternative to cost intensive Ultra-wideband (UWB) applications as long as no centimeter accuracy is required. In comparison to using UWB, a beacon based tracking system utilizing AoA technology can be set up at much lesser costs and also has an advantage of a longer battery lifetime. Practical applications of this technology can include tracking systems in logistics, for example, which can make a decisive contribution to maximizing warehouse operations.
